Feathers - 3 - Free-fall

Who we are and all they are
you know right here now
on the board but what comes first
comes along unnoticed
Sunda, Ayla, Reena, the little embrace we must
get to know the young air darker
as we rip for every ground
all that is missing we'll not know
where I imagine her long fingers
have only ourselves to sell
and if it grows holding its warmth
to get the hang of it over the free-fall
and then dying off the nail shooting
at each passage
we have never risen
from a slant of the evening sun
I picture her here
cracking over the details in her lap
I picture her here
and no matter how long in grace.
